INSIGHT

Nature And Timelessness Create Golden Holidays

  • People most vividly remember holidays spent in nature with a sense of timelessness and flow.
  • Those memories often involve simple exploration and imaginative activities like cloud watching.
INSIGHT

Connection Beats High-Speed Attractions

  • Strong family connection is a recurring feature of treasured holiday memories.
  • Fast-paced, high-stimulation holidays rarely appear as people's top remembered experiences.
ADVICE

Plan Minimal, Proximal Holidays

  • Try minimal, low-stimulation holidays to give kids space to decompress and create.
  • Stay physically close and engaged for the first day or two, then gradually back off to allow independent play.
